光速是多少?

光速是指光在真空中传播的速度,它的数值约为每秒299,792,458米。换句话说,光速意味着在真空中,光会以每秒约300,000公里的速度移动。这个速度非常之快,实际上,光速是所有已知的速度中最快的。
运用光速,我们可以更深入地理解时间、空间和相对论等物理概念。根据爱因斯坦的相对论理论,光速是宇宙中的速度极限,任何物质或信息都无法超越这一速度。这也意味着,当我们观察遥远的星系时,实际上我们是在看过去的光线,因为光速快到足以使光线穿越巨大的宇宙空间并到达我们的眼睛。
光速的意义远远不止于此。在现代科学和技术中,我们利用光速来测量和计算各种事物的速度、距离和时间。例如,GPS导航系统就利用了从地球上的卫星发送信号到接收器的时间差来确定位置。还有许多实际应用,例如医疗诊断、通信技术和天文学研究等,都需要对光速的精确测量和理解。
总而言之,光速是物理学中一个非常重要的概念,它不仅仅是一个数值,更是科学发现和技术进步的基础。它的存在和特性,使我们能够更好地理解宇宙中的各种现象,以及改善我们的生活和世界。

What is the speed of light?
The speed of light refers to the speed at which light travels in a vacuum, and its value is approximately 299,792,458 meters per second. In other words, the speed of light means that in a vacuum, light will move at about 300,000 kilometers per second. This speed is incredibly fast, in fact, the speed of light is the fastest among all known speeds.
By using the speed of light, we can gain a deeper understanding of physical concepts such as time, space, and relativity. According to Albert Einstein's theory of relativity, the speed of light is the ultimate speed limit in the universe, and nothing, including matter or information, can exceed this speed. This also means that when we observe distant galaxies, we are actually seeing light from the past, because the speed of light is fast enough to travel through vast cosmic distances and reach our eyes.
The significance of the speed of light goes far beyond this. In modern science and technology, we utilize the speed of light to measure and calculate the speed, distance, and time of various objects. For example, GPS navigation systems use the time difference between signals sent from satellites to receivers on Earth to determine positions. There are many practical applications as well, such as medical diagnostics, communication technology, and astronomical research, all of which require precise measurement and understanding of the speed of light.
In conclusion, the speed of light is a highly important concept in physics. It is not just a numerical value, but also the foundation of scientific discoveries and technological advancements. Its existence and characteristics enable us to better understand various phenomena in the universe and improve our lives and the world around us.
